How to Childproof Stove Knobs
The kitchen is one of the most dangerous zones for children of all ages, with the stove being a major safety hazard. Properly childproofing your stove knobs is one major step you should take to keep children from accidentally burning themselves or starting a fire.
Things You'll Need
- Stove knob covers
- Stove knob locks
Instructions
Write down the make and model number of your stove, and visit the hardware store to search for stove knob covers. Stove knob covers slide into place over your existing knobs, making it difficult for children to turn the knobs. Make sure the stove knob covers click into place over your knobs and test them to ensure they are properly installed. Properly installed stove knobs will make it impossible to turn the knob. Remove the knobs completely from your stove. You can usually pull off the knobs by hand and keep them in a small box where little hands can't reach them. Only take out knobs and re-install them when you are planning to use the stove. Install knob locks under pre-existing stove knobs. These plastic disks hold the knob in place, making it impossible to turn while they are installed. To use the stove, simply remove the knob, take off the disk and put the knob back in place.
